Here is a great opportunity to add hay production ground to your current farm or a great place to start a small farm in a great location. The Rainey Family Farm has been owned by the same family since 1930. At one time, the farm boasted a large-scale turkey farm and cattle operation. The land has a lot of history, and the next owner will be blessed to create their legacy on it. From hay production to livestock production and significant hunting opportunities, the farm offers 30 acres of productive bottom hay ground and 40 acres open in total. There is a history of mature bucks that call this property home, as well as turkeys and small game. The large pond tucked away in the hardwoods offers beautiful serenity. If you are looking for a good location for land in the Ozarks, this listing checks that box. You have colleges, large towns, the Lake of the Ozarks, and more nearby. It is centrally located between Camdenton, Lebanon, and Rolla. The property also has over a half mile of county road frontage and is no problem for getting large equipment on.
